Llanrhaeadr Community Energy Project

Steve Jones
As part of a local energy project we have audited 10 housing types in our village for their energy performance, and looked at teh best options fo energy generation for our community. One the back of this study we are preparing to launch a community owned hydro initiative. www.llanrhaeadr.org.uk

Garden City Community Garden

Garden City Community Garden
The Garden City Community Garden is located in a mountain community located in Xindian, northern Taiwan.
